A local primary school in Esher seeks a reliable Assistant Caretaker to work part-time from 5pm to 6:30pm, Monday to Friday. The role involves site security, maintenance tasks, and ensuring a safe environment for students.
Ideal candidates will have:
- Good English skills
- Basic IT proficiency
- Experience in maintenance and DIY
Benefits include discounted rates for staff, an engaging work environment, and access to facilities like the community swimming pool.
